Exploring the Interface of Nature-based Solutions and Security

November 13, 2023

Prof. Laszlo Pinter has been invited to give a public lecture at the Association of Foreign Affairs in Lund, Sweden on November 13, 2023. 

Topic: Nature-based solutions as purposeful interventions to address urban and rural sustainability issues and challenges. 

Building on their accepted definitions, nature-based solutions represent a class of diverse and purposeful interventions making use of nature to address urban and rural sustainability challenges. Many of the challenges involve a threat to human and non-human security, associated with the supply of basic goods and services, such as food, water, shelter, energy or health, and their combinations. Climate change may act as a threat multiplier that affects these and other related challenges. The talk will aim to weave together insights from separate threads of research on NBS and climate risk and security to identify dimensions on the interface that may represent opportunities for research, policy and practice.

The Association of Foreign Affairs in Lund (abbreviated to UPF Lund from its Swedish name, Utrikespolitiska Föreningen) provides a space for students and those interested in exploring the world of politics and foreign affairs.
